Physiotherapist-led treatment for femoroacetabular impingement syndrome (the PhysioFIRST study): an assessor-blinded, limited disclosure randomised controlled trial.

| Περίληψη: | Objective: We evaluated the effect of physiotherapist-led treatment with targeted-strengthening (STRENGTH) compared with physiotherapist-led treatment with standardised-stretching (STRETCH) on hip-related quality of life (QOL) and patient-perceived Global Rating of Change (GROC) at 6 months in people with femoroacetabular impingement (FAI) syndrome. Methods: Assessor-blind, limited disclosure, parallel, superiority randomised controlled trial. Participants aged 18-50 years with FAI syndrome were recruited and randomly allocated (1:1 ratio) to receive 6 months of STRENGTH or STRETCH treatment. Primary outcomes were change in (1) hip-related QOL (International Hip Outcome Tool-33 (iHOT-33, 0-100 points)); and (2) GROC-pain and GROC-function at 6 months. Secondary analysis included dichotomised GROC ('improved' and 'not improved') and hip muscle strength. Analyses were by intention to treat. Results: 154 participants (STRENGTH n=79 (53% women, mean 35 (SD 9) years); STRETCH n=75 (45% women, mean 36 (SD 9) years)) were included. There was no difference between groups for change in hip-related QOL (mean difference (95% CI) 0.2 (-5.9 to 6.3)) or patient-perceived global improvement (GROC-pain 0.2 (-0.2 to 0.7), p=0.23; GROC-function 0.3 (-0.1 to 0.6)) at 6 months. 72% of STRENGTH were improved for GROC-pain (OR 2.36 (1.15 to 4.84)) compared with 52% of STRETCH. STRENGTH had greater improvements than STRETCH in hip strength. Both groups improved in iHOT-33 over 6 months (STRENGTH 19.2 (15.7 to 22.8), STRETCH 20.8 (17.1 to 24.5) points). Conclusion: There was no superior physiotherapist-led treatment to improve hip-related QOL in people with FAI syndrome, but secondary analysis indicated that targeted strengthening resulted in greater improvements in perceived pain and hip muscle strength at 6 months. Hip-related QOL improved in both groups by clinically meaningful amounts. Trial Registration Number: ACTRN12617001350314. (© Author(s) (or their employer(s)) 2026. Re-use permitted under CC BY-NC.
